1. E-Learning Platforms
E-learning platforms have revolutionized education in South Africa by offering flexible learning options that cater to diverse learner needs. Key features of e-learning platforms include:
- Accessibility: Students can access courses from anywhere, breaking geographical barriers.
- Diverse Course Offerings: These platforms offer a wide range of subjects and skills, fitting various career paths.
- Self-Paced Learning: Learners can study at their own pace, fitting their education around other commitments.
2. Virtual Classrooms
Virtual classrooms are becoming an integral part of education, enabling real-time interaction between teachers and students. Benefits include:
- Engagement: Interactive tools like polls, quizzes, and discussions keep students engaged.
- Global Connections: Students can connect with peers and educators worldwide, enhancing cultural exchange.
- Flexibility: Classes can be recorded and revisited for later learning.
3. Learning Management Systems (LMS)
Learning Management Systems help educators manage and deliver content effectively. Features of LMS include:
- Content Management: Organize course materials, assessments, and feedback efficiently.
- Analytics: Track student performance and progress through data insights.
- Collaboration Tools: Facilitate communication and collaboration among students and staff.
4. Gamification in Education
Gamification incorporates game-like elements into the learning process to increase motivation and participation. This can be achieved through:
- Achievements and Rewards: Students earn badges or points for completing tasks.
- Interactive Challenges: Friendly competitions encourage peer engagement and learning.
- Scenario-Based Learning: Real-life challenges in a game setting foster critical thinking and problem-solving skills.
5. The Role of Artificial Intelligence (AI)
AI is transforming education by providing personalized learning experiences. Here’s how:
- Adaptive Learning: AI systems analyze student performance to tailor content suited to each learner's needs.
- Automated Feedback: Quick assessments help students understand their strengths and areas for improvement.
- Virtual Tutors: AI-driven chatbots can offer 24/7 assistance for homework and learning resources.
